User :   I had endometrial cancer 4 years ago...stage 1b...no lymph node affected. My CA 125 last Jan. was 37, retested 3 months later down to 31. With my most recent visit to oncologist, he said I did not have to come back for a year, but my CA 125 was elevated again to 42. I have been diagnosed with fatty liver. Could that be affecting the increased levels?

Doctor :   and now coming on your elevated levels of CA 125
Doctor :   there are many non cancerous conditions that can cause an elevated CA 125 level and most prominent being LIVER disease . since you do have a history so the elevation is because of the liver pathology and not because of any cancer re occurrence
